Transaction a59e02837e1c4139940403693708d66e58bb266287fcd44bbbf6890d821613f2
1 Input
1 Output
-
a59e02837e1c4139940403693708d66e58bb266287fcd44bbbf6890d821613f2:0
- value
- 106371455
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4f47cba0f9d98e9a36a7bb1da4738e68e73f65e
- address
- bc1qcn68ews0nkvwngm20wca53ecu6888aj708ela2